When Pam Bondi was elected as Florida's attorney general in 2010, Florida was #1 in the country for pill mills - places where you could literally walk in with cash and walk out with pain pills. Dealers came from all over the country to buy the pain meds and take them back to their state. After Pam was elected, she shut down some 98 pill mills in the state. Fighting addiction from her position is a priority for her.
